:: Temporomandibular Joint Dysfunction, (TMJ or TMD)

TMJ dysfunction produces headaches and facial pain. It can be caused by problems with the muscles that move the jaw or it may result from injury to the jaw joint. Dr. Orr has more than 30 years of experience in the treatment of TMJ and provides  both non-surgical and surgical treatments for this difficult condition. The vast majority of patients experience relief from pain and improved function without oral surgery via non-invasive treatment protocols.  Oral surgery may be recommended for a small percentage of patients for whom TMJ repair or disc replacement is indicated.

:: Reconstructive Dental Implant Surgery for Permanent Tooth Replacement Through Osseointegration

Reconstructive Dental Implant Surgey for Permanent tooth replacement. Oral surgery perfomed by Dr. Orr.Osseointegration - grafting precious metal implants into bone  is a revolutionary advance in restorative dentistry that has been proven successful in over thirty years of clinical trials. Dental implants provide a fixed anchor for single tooth or multiple tooth replacement.

Dental implants replace missing teeth and can be used as an alternative to dentures and other non-fixed replacement options. Bone grafting with implants may be also used for facial and soft tissue reconstruction needed as a result of cancer, birth defects, or injury.
